Overview of the Devices

The Polar Ignite 3 is renowned for its focus on fitness and health metrics, offering advanced heart rate tracking, sleep analysis, and recovery insights. Meanwhile, the Apple Watch SE emphasizes seamless integration with the Apple ecosystem, providing comprehensive health monitoring alongside lifestyle features.

Heart Rate Monitoring Capabilities

The Polar Ignite 3 utilizes a proprietary sensor technology that provides continuous, accurate heart rate data during workouts and rest. Its Precision Prime sensor ensures minimal inaccuracies, especially during high-intensity activities.

The Apple Watch SE employs optical heart rate sensors that have improved over the years. In 2026, its algorithms are highly refined, offering reliable data for daily use, though some athletes report slight discrepancies during vigorous exercise.

Additional Heart Health Features

Polar Ignite 3 includes features like Heart Rate Variability (HRV) analysis, stress tracking, and personalized recovery recommendations. It also integrates with Polar’s fitness ecosystem for in-depth health insights.

Apple Watch SE offers ECG capabilities, irregular rhythm notifications, and a fall detection feature that can alert emergency services. Its Health app consolidates data for a comprehensive view of heart health.

Accuracy and Reliability in 2026

By 2026, both devices have significantly improved in accuracy. Polar’s dedicated focus on fitness metrics makes it slightly more reliable for athletes and those monitoring specific heart conditions.

Apple’s broader ecosystem and regular software updates ensure its sensors remain competitive, though occasional discrepancies during extreme activities are still reported.

User Experience and Interface

Polar Ignite 3 features a straightforward interface tailored for fitness enthusiasts, with dedicated metrics and easy navigation. Its focus is on delivering precise health data without unnecessary distractions.

The Apple Watch SE offers a more versatile experience, combining health features with notifications, apps, and customizable watch faces. Its intuitive interface appeals to a broad user base.
